10 Effective Meal Ideas for the 75 Hard Diet

Transitioning from theory to practical application, here are ten effective meal ideas to incorporate into your 75 Hard meal plan. These recipes enhance flavor, support macro balance, and utilize superfoods to contribute to your overall health.

1. Protein-Rich Breakfast Scramble

Starting your day with a protein-rich breakfast can set the tone for your energy levels throughout the day. A simple scramble with eggs, spinach, diced tomatoes, and lean turkey can provide the nutrients needed to kick off the morning. Pair this with a side of high-fiber foods like avocado for added healthy fats.

2. Nutritious Energy-Boosting Smoothies

Smoothies are an excellent way to incorporate fruits and vegetables into your diet while on the go. Choose ingredients like spinach, banana, almond milk, and a scoop of protein powder for a quick nutritious breakfast or snack. Including superfoods like chia seeds provides extra health benefits and keeps you satisfied.

3. Low-Carb Lunch Wraps

Create satisfying low-carb wraps using lettuce leaves as a base. Fill them with grilled chicken, assorted vegetables, and a dollop of hummus or yogurt for flavor. This keeps your lunches light and nutritious while adhering to the 75 Hard principles.

4. High-Quality Protein Snacks

Snacking wisely is vital during the 75 Hard challenge. Consider options such as protein shakes, Greek yogurt, or nut butter with apple slices for an energy-dense and satisfying boost.

5. Colorful Grain Bowls

A colorful grain bowl can provide a balanced meal option featuring quinoa or brown rice as a base. Add grilled vegetables, a protein source like chickpeas or chicken, and drizzle with a clean eating salad dressing for maximum flavor and nutrients.

6. Lean Protein Post-Workout Meals

Following a rigorous workout, it's essential to refuel your body. Prepare lean protein options, such as salmon or turkey, which are beneficial for muscle recovery. Pair them with roasted sweet potatoes and steamed broccoli in order to incorporate healthy carbohydrates and fiber.

7. Clean Eating Dinner Options

For dinner, aim for balance by choosing lean protein, healthy fats, and complex carbohydrates. Grilled or baked fish accompanied by asparagus or a side salad rich in seasonal vegetables can turn into a delicious and satisfying meal.

8. Easy Salad Recipes

Salads can easily be transformed into hearty meals. Combine leafy greens with a variety of toppings such as grilled chicken, beans, nuts, seeds, and fresh vegetables. Experiment with different dressings to keep your salads interesting and enjoyable.

9. Quick and Healthy Desserts

Indulging in desserts while maintaining a diet is achievable with nutrient-dense recipes. Opt for low-calorie options like chia pudding made with almond milk and topped with berries, ensuring you can satisfy your sweet tooth without derail your goals.

10. Meal Replacement Options

For those busy days, having convenient meal replacement options can be invaluable. Look for high-protein meal replacement shakes that are low in sugar and meet the nutrient requirements of your diet plan.

Q&A Section

What are effective snacks for the 75 Hard diet?

Effective snacks include high-protein options like Greek yogurt, air-fried chickpeas, and low-sugar protein bars. Incorporating snacks that are low in calories but high in nutritional density can keep you satisfied between meals.

How can I meal prep quickly for the 75 Hard challenge?

To meal prep efficiently, consider batch cooking proteins, chopping vegetables, and diversifying your meals in a single sitting. Using freezer-friendly containers can preserve meals for later use without compromising health benefits.

What are some healthy fats to include in my meals?

Incorporating healthy fats such as avocados, nuts, seeds, and olive oil can provide energy and support weight loss during the 75 Hard challenge. Focus on a balanced intake of fats to enhance overall meal quality.

How do I maintain variety in my meals?

Maintaining variety can be achieved through creative cooking techniques, experimenting with international cuisines, and rotating ingredients weekly. This approach prevents monotony and reinforces consistent dietary adherence.

Should I focus on calorie tracking during the 75 Hard diet?

While calorie tracking can provide insights into your dietary consumption, the focus should be on nutritional quality rather than quantity alone. Combining mindful eating habits with a focus on healthy foods can optimize your 75 Hard experience.
